Power Quest was good and so was the Game Boy version of Killer Instinct. Those were the days!
If we're talking WonderSwan, take your pick. Literally every game SNK put on the thing is worth owning. Most of the NGPC fighters have been ported on the Switch if you're into that.
Lastly, there are some indie NGPC-styled fighters worth checking out, namely Pocket Fighter EX and Ganbatte Karate.
